Microplastics, measuring less than 5 mm in diameter, are now found various environmental media, including soil, water, and air, have infiltrated the food chain, ultimately becoming a part of human diet. This study offers comprehensive examination intricate nexus between microplastics health, thereby contributing to existing knowledge on subject. Sources microplastics, microfibers from textiles, personal care products, wastewater treatment plants, among others, were assessed. The meticulously examined diverse routes microplastic exposure—ingestion, inhalation, dermal contact—offering insights into associated health risks. Notably, ingestion has been linked gastrointestinal disturbances, endocrine disruption, potential transmission pathogenic bacteria. Inhalation airborne emerges as critical concern, with possible implications for respiratory cardiovascular health. Dermal contact, although explored, raises prospect skin irritation allergic reactions. impacts COVID-19 pollution also highlighted. Throughout manuscript, need deeper mechanistic understanding interactions systems is emphasized, underscoring urgency further research public awareness.

Biomass and plastics are two of the most common municipal solid wastes globally that have continuously placed a burden on environment. It is therefore important they properly recycled. Thermochemical co-conversion offers valuable opportunity to recycle biomass simultaneously into biochar, which reduces time cost recycling them individually while producing material with wide range applications. This study review published literature discusses thermochemical co-processing plastic biochar. was observed co-pyrolysis co-hydrothermal carbonization commonly utilized technologies for this process. The characteristics different been thermochemically converted biochar were compared. properties resulting affected by feedstock composition, pre-treatment blending ratio, reactor's configuration, reaction temperature, presence catalyst. Most studies found treating feedstocks separately resulted in lower yield than processing together. created procedure has used as soil additive an adsorbent water treatment. Future perspectives suggestions, such necessity some technical advancement, biochar's economic benefits, improved government participation, raised social awareness, also made. These factors potential propel field great horizons.
